首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用python读取远程文本文件

使用Python读取远程文本文件可以通过以下步骤实现:

  1. 导入必要的库:
代码语言:txt
复制
import urllib.request
  1. 定义远程文件的URL地址:
代码语言:txt
复制
url = "远程文件的URL地址"
  1. 使用urllib.request.urlopen()函数打开URL链接:
代码语言:txt
复制
response = urllib.request.urlopen(url)
  1. 读取远程文件内容:
代码语言:txt
复制
data = response.read()
  1. 将读取的内容进行解码(如果需要):
代码语言:txt
复制
text = data.decode('utf-8')

完整的代码示例:

代码语言:txt
复制
import urllib.request

url = "远程文件的URL地址"
response = urllib.request.urlopen(url)
data = response.read()
text = data.decode('utf-8')

print(text)

这段代码使用Python的urllib.request库实现了读取远程文本文件的功能。首先,通过urlopen()函数打开远程文件的URL链接,然后使用read()方法读取文件内容。如果需要,可以使用decode()方法对读取的内容进行解码,指定相应的字符编码。最后,将解码后的文本内容进行处理或输出。

使用Python读取远程文本文件的应用场景包括但不限于:

  • 网络爬虫:从网页中获取文本内容进行分析和处理。
  • 数据分析:读取远程文本文件中的数据,进行统计、分析和可视化。
  • 日志分析:读取远程服务器上的日志文件,进行故障排查和性能优化。

腾讯云相关产品和产品介绍链接地址:

请注意,以上提到的腾讯云产品仅作为示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

12分4秒

day26_IO流/12-尚硅谷-Java语言高级-使用FileInputStream不能读取文本文件的测试

12分4秒

day26_IO流/12-尚硅谷-Java语言高级-使用FileInputStream不能读取文本文件的测试

12分4秒

day26_IO流/12-尚硅谷-Java语言高级-使用FileInputStream不能读取文本文件的测试

8分9秒

尚硅谷_Python基础_124_文件_简单读取.avi

5分0秒

11-示例3-使用远程配置

9分0秒

使用VSCode和delve进行golang远程debug

14分40秒

尚硅谷_Python基础_125_文件_读取大文件.avi

24分4秒

Python 人工智能 数据分析库 19 pandas的使用以及二项分布 7 pandas读取数据

12分7秒

python使用ftp

8分0秒

云上的Python之VScode远程调试、绘图及数据分析

1.7K
1分38秒

JShaman(在线JS加密)使用技巧:保存和读取配置

14分16秒

06-使用开发工具推送镜像到远程仓库

领券